Closed depfu[bot] closed 1 month ago
All modified and coverable lines are covered by tests :white_check_mark:
Project coverage is 91.08%. Comparing base (
3fc2fc7
) to head (f2f1d95
).
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
Closed in favor of #762.
Here is everything you need to know about this update. Please take a good look at what changed and the test results before merging this pull request.
What changed?
✳️ rubocop-performance (1.20.2 → 1.21.0) · Repo · Changelog
Release Notes
1.21.0
Does any of this look wrong? Please let us know.
Commits
See the full diff on Github. The new version differs by 16 commits:
Cut 1.21.0
Update Changelog
Merge pull request #449 from koic/fix_false_positive_for_performance_redundant_block_call
[Fix #448] Fix a false positive for `Performance/RedundantBlockCall`
Merge pull request #446 from koic/support_prism
Support Prism as a Ruby parser
Tweak specs for `Performance/UnfreezeString`
Use RuboCop RSpec 2.27
Merge pull request #443 from koic/disalbe_performance_casecmp_by_default
[Fix #240] Disable `Performance/Casecmp` cop
Remove redundant `expect_no_offenses` keyword arguments
Tweak offense highlight range for `Performance/ChainArrayAllocation`
Use `Range#join` instead of generic `Parser::Source::Range.new`
Merge pull request #439 from koic/fix_a_false_positive_for_performance_chain_array_allocation
[Fix #437] Fix a false positive for `Performance/ChainArrayAllocation`
Switch back docs version to master
↗️ rubocop (indirect, 1.60.2 → 1.62.1) · Repo · Changelog
Release Notes
1.62.1
1.62.0
1.61.0
Does any of this look wrong? Please let us know.
Commits
See the full diff on Github. The new version differs by more commits than we can show here.
↗️ rubocop-ast (indirect, 1.30.0 → 1.31.2) · Repo · Changelog
Commits
See the full diff on Github. The new version differs by 24 commits:
Cut 1.31.2
Improve error message when passing wrong `parser_engine` and accept strings
Restore docs/antora.yml
Cut 1.31.1
Update Changelog
[Fix #282] Remove Prism from runtime dependency
Satisfy rubocop
Restore docs/antora.yml
Cut 1.31
Update Changelog
Remove useless `TARGET_RUBY_VERSION` env var
Make `Node#left_curly_brace?` aware of lambda brace
Support Prism as a Ruby parser
Fix a build error (#280)
Drop Ruby 2.6 runtime support
Fix a build error (#278)
CI against Ruby 3.3 (#274)
Bump actions/setup-python from 4 to 5
Support `Parser::Ruby34`
Suppress false positives of `RSpec/RedundantPredicateMatcher`
Bump actions/checkout from 3 to 4 (#269)
Suppress RuboCop offenses
Fix a few small things in NodeTypes docs (#273)
Suppress a RuboCop offense
Depfu will automatically keep this PR conflict-free, as long as you don't add any commits to this branch yourself. You can also trigger a rebase manually by commenting with
@depfu rebase
.All Depfu comment commands